Today at the Atomexpo-2017 exhibition, opened in Moscow, the head of the Fennovoima company, Minna Forstrem, told about the plans to start the construction of NPP "Hanhikivi-1” in 2018. Domestic investments of Finland will amount to 2.8 billion euros. According to Minna Forstrem, it’s a good opportunity for business of Finland. The whole project is estimated at €7 billion.

Russia invests €2.4 billion, all other funds are bank loans. The Bank of Foreign Economic Activity of Russia develops a road map for NPP financing from the Russian side.

The construction of NPP "Hanhikivi-1" will start in 2018 and last until 2023. The start is scheduled for 2024.
